Commercial Description:
XX. It usually means bigger. Richer. And we can think of no better way to describe the taste of this even-bolder take on our classic, Black Butte Porter. Black Butte XX is an imperial porter with a lot more malt and hops, a wealth of coffee, cocoa nibs and aged in bourbon oak barrels. XX. It also means 20. Enjoy one during our 20th anniversary. On the flavor scale - It’s legendary.

Bottle pours black with a light brown thin head. Aroma is sweet, roasted almonds, black licorice, and roasted malts. Tons of flavor to this one. Dark roasted malts with a vanilla sweetness, coffee, with noticeable hints of bourbon and oak and a slightly bitter chocolate finish. Coats the mouth with goodness.

Pours black, but brown around the edges with a tan head that retains pretty well. Smell of anise, roast, vanilla, ash, and the smell of green wood on a still living tree. Same thing with the living wood in the taste, as well as cocoa, vanilla, caramel, charcoal, and some roastiness. Thicker than medium body and light carbonation; quite smooth. Pretty tasty, though I don’t know that I’d worry about getting more of this.

22 oz bottle. Pours a clear dark brown body with a one finger fizzy dark brown head. Some decent retention for being so thin looking. The nose has loads of coffee. Cocoa, roast, light vanilla, wood, and maybe a bit of bourbon. Very thick and hearty smelling. The flavor is dry and roasty up front with lots of cocoa powder. A slight astringent bite going on. Fades to a very lightly bourbon laced finish with touches of oak. Mouthfeel is pretty full and thick with moderate fizzy prickly carbonation. Much sweeter on the lingering finish. Overall, this was alright, but not one that blew me away at all.

This poured black in color with a moderate brown head of fine bubbles that fades away. When sniffing this immediately reminded me of toffee dipped in chocolate with nuts. This was followed by dark fruit, woodsmoke, mild bourbon, asparagus and a peppery spice. In the mouth it was medium to bull-bodied with concentrated flavor and a rich midpalate balanced by the carbonation. Overall, this has nice sweetness, dominated by toffee in both the nose and mouth, to it and good complexity. This appears as it it will age well for 6 - 12 months but beyond that the sweetness may overpower.
